Your goats will need protection from the elements that includes adequate ventilation. A simple three sided lean to run in shelter works quite well. If you are lucky enough to have a barn, or you build one, goat areas can be partitioned off inside. There are goat shelters made out of about anything your imagination can dream up… pallets, tarps, recylcled kids playhouses and plastic barrels. All work fine if it provides a roof over their heads and protection from the elements.

Whatever you choose, good ventilation is a must as well as ease of cleaning. A smart shed for large paddocks or fields includes skids on the bottom so they can simply be moved to a new area.
